WebDuring the mature stage, the heaviest rain and (sometimes) hail fall from the storm. As long as the updraft can keep feeding the thunderstorm warm, humid air, it will continue to grow and intensify. However, the downdraft will usually end up killing off the thunderstorm as it will cut off the updraft’s supply of warm, humid air. This is the most dangerous stage when tornadoes, large hail, damaging winds, and flash … WebIn the mature stage of a thunderstorm, the warmed air continues to rise until it reaches even warmer air and can rise no further. Often this 'cap' is the tropopause. The air is instead forced to spread out, giving the storm a characteristic anvil shape. The resulting cloud is called cumulonimbus incus.
